Job Summary
Job Summary
2 immediate openings for: COVID-19 Support Staff at Roseland Elementary. Definition: The COVID-19 Support Staff will provide assistance in various areas related to COVID-19. Schedule: Monday - Friday: 8:00 am to 4:00 pm This is a categorically funded position.
Requirements / Qualifications
Requirements / Qualifications
Education, Experience and Other Qualifications: High school diploma or beyond. Must pass a basic proficiency test for No Child Left Behind compliance or possess an A.A. or higher, or 48 units at an accredited institution of higher learning. Bilingual English/Spanish highly desirable Experience supervising and instructing children is desirable. Good interpersonal skills; friendly, positive and cooperative with all staff. First Aid certification required. CPR certification desired. Licenses and Other Requirements: Fingerprint and TB clearance This position may require work to be performed during non-standard hours such as evening and weekend hours.
